今天给大家带来的是Android基础测试题(二)
题目要求:
定义一个5位长度的整型数组并初始化,然后构建方法根据用户传入的数字判断是否存在数组中,如果存在,返回所在位置,如果不存在,返回-1
首先第一步,我们要根据用户输入的数字,在数组中查询出是否存在返回的位置。
//n储存用户输入的数
//如果存在,返回位置,如果不存在,返回-1
static int test(double n){
double[] nums={15,25.5,56,45,14.5};
for (int i = 0; i < nums.length; i++) {
if(nums[i]==n)
return i;
}
return -1;
}
千万别以为这样就完了,我们后面还要调用方法呢。接着我们继续
public static void main(String[] args) {
int i=test(1);//调用方法
if(i!=-1){
System.out.println("存在,下标是:"+i);
}else{
System.out.println("不存在");
}
}